On November 11 in SVRSevern Valley Railway history.
- 1972 At the height of the 'Nabarro' era and following the controversial AGM of the Guarantee Company eight days earlier, the Severn Valley Railway Association held its first AGM.[1]
- 1972 Working members at Arley staged a bonfire and fireworks display as a break from restoring the station.[1]
- 2007 Central Trains passed over its franchised passenger services, including those to Kidderminster from Birmingham New Street and Birmingham Snow Hill, to London Midland.
- 2018 GWR 2857 Heavy Goods Loco carried a "100" headcode for the centenary of Armistice Day.
